编程要学的科目是什么科目

fiy 其他 17

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程是一门综合性的学科,学习编程需要涉及多个科目。下面是编程学习中常见的几个科目:

    1.计算机科学基础:学习计算机科学的基本概念和原理,包括计算机体系结构、操作系统、数据结构和算法等。这些基础知识是编程的基石,对于理解和解决问题非常重要。

    2.编程语言:选择一门编程语言作为学习的工具,常见的编程语言有Python、Java、C++等。学习编程语言的语法、语义和编程范式,掌握基本的编码技巧和规范。

    3.数据库:学习数据库的基本概念和操作,了解数据的存储、查询和管理,掌握SQL语言和关系数据库的使用。

    4.网络与安全:学习计算机网络的基本原理和协议,了解网络通信和数据传输的过程,掌握网络编程和网络安全的基本知识。

    5.前端开发:学习网页设计和开发的基本知识,包括HTML、CSS和JavaScript等技术,掌握网页布局、样式设计和交互效果的实现。

    6.后端开发:学习服务器端的开发技术,包括Web框架、数据库操作、API设计等,掌握服务器端的编程和数据处理能力。

    7.软件工程:学习软件开发的流程和方法,包括需求分析、系统设计、项目管理等,掌握团队协作和软件质量保证的技巧。

    除了以上几个科目,还有一些与编程相关的技能也是值得学习的,比如版本控制、测试和调试、性能优化等。编程是一个持续学习的过程,不断积累和提升自己的技能才能成为一名优秀的程序员。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一个广泛的领域,涉及多个科目。以下是学习编程所涉及的主要科目:

    1. 计算机科学基础:学习计算机科学的基本概念和原理,包括数据结构、算法、计算机体系结构等。这些基础知识是编程的基石,对于理解和解决问题至关重要。

    2. 编程语言:学习一种或多种编程语言,如Python、Java、C++等。编程语言是用来编写计算机程序的工具,通过学习不同的编程语言,可以实现不同的功能和解决不同的问题。

    3. 网络和互联网技术:学习网络基础知识,了解互联网的工作原理和常用的网络协议。这对于开发网络应用程序和理解互联网技术非常重要。

    4. 数据库:学习数据库的设计和管理,了解SQL语言以及常见的数据库管理系统,如MySQL、Oracle等。数据库是用来存储和管理数据的工具,在大多数应用程序中都起到重要的作用。

    5. 软件工程:学习软件开发的过程和方法,包括需求分析、设计、开发、测试和维护等。软件工程帮助开发人员更好地组织和管理项目,提高开发效率和质量。

    除了上述科目,还有其他一些重要的科目,如人工智能、机器学习、数据科学等,这些科目在当前的技术发展中变得越来越重要。此外,数学和逻辑思维也是编程的基础,对于解决问题和优化算法有着重要的影响。

    需要注意的是,编程是一个不断学习和发展的领域,随着技术的更新和发展,还会出现新的科目和技术。因此,作为一个编程学习者,要保持学习的热情和持续的学习态度,不断更新自己的知识和技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程是一门综合性学科,涉及到多个科目。下面是一些常见的编程学科:

    1.计算机科学基础:学习计算机的基本原理、数据结构、算法和计算机组成原理等。

    2.编程语言:学习一种或多种编程语言,如Python、Java、C++等。掌握语法、数据类型、控制流程、函数等基本概念和技术。

    3.数据库:学习数据库的设计和管理,如SQL语言、关系数据库理论、数据建模等。

    4.网络编程:学习网络通信的基本原理和技术,如HTTP、TCP/IP、Socket编程等。

    5.操作系统:学习操作系统的原理和管理,如进程管理、文件系统、内存管理等。

    6.软件工程:学习软件开发的过程和方法,如需求分析、设计、测试、项目管理等。

    7.人工智能:学习机器学习、深度学习、自然语言处理等人工智能相关的技术。

    8.Web开发:学习前端开发技术,如HTML、CSS、JavaScript等,以及后端开发技术,如服务器端语言、数据库集成等。

    9.移动应用开发:学习开发移动应用的技术,如Android开发、iOS开发等。

    10.算法与数据结构:深入学习各种算法和数据结构,如排序算法、图算法、树等。

    11.安全与加密:学习网络安全和数据加密的原理和技术,如密码学、防火墙、漏洞分析等。

    12.图形学:学习计算机图形学的基本原理和技术,如渲染、动画、虚拟现实等。

    以上只是一些常见的编程学科,实际上编程的范围非常广泛,还涉及到其他领域的知识,如物联网、大数据、云计算等。根据个人的兴趣和需求,可以选择学习其中的一些或多个学科。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部